Wielding his God Arc, Lenka rashly leaps into action to save Eric who is injured. God Eaters Lindow, Sakuya, and Soma of the First Unit arrive to help, but Aragami Vajra is powerful and Lindow and the unit have their hands full. Ultimately, Lenka is injured and falls unconscious, only to awaken in a holding cell. He is being detained for disobeying orders and is told by Tsubaki, “I should never have let you go.” Meanwhile, there is a girl God Eater who has left the Russian Branch, headed toward the Far East Branch.

Lenka is frustrated to learn that the Aegis Project has a long, long way to go. In order to complete the project, massive amounts of the natural resource known as Oracle must be harvested from the Aragami. As Lenka stands dumbfounded, Soma kicks him out of the way and tells him, “What we can do is hunt Aragami. That’s all.” The veteran God Eaters, Lindow and Soma, are away when the next assignment comes in, so Sakuya, who has been left in charge, decides to hunt lesser Aragami. But knowing that the bigger the core, the faster the Aegis Project can be completed, Lenka suggests that the mission target large-type Aragami. When Kota and Alisa both agree with Lenka, Sakuya decides to take three rookies on a hunt for the large-type Aragami…Vajra.

Lenka and Alisa are rescued from a violent attack of Aragami, then taken by Lindow to Asyl (asylum), a place where people who were turned away at the Fenrir Far East Branch refugee center live and support each other. Making the rounds with Lindow, Lenka comes upon a shocking sight. Lenka is unable to answer when Lindow pointedly asks why he wants to destroy Aragami. A Vajra appears and moves threateningly toward Asyl, and Lindow orders Lenka to “Go back and protect everyone. No one is to die...including yourself.

A change is occurring in Lenka’s body due to over-adaptation to the Oracle Cell. Lenka is in a dilemma when told that while he cannot escape inevitable death, if he resigns as a God Eater, he may be able to prolong his life for a little while. Meanwhile, a briefing is being held on the “Meteorite Strategy,” the crucial mission necessary to execute the Aegis Plan. Lenka’s tactical skills have been recognized and he is appointed a leader. Lenka learns that members of other units avoid Soma who has been labeled a “shinigami” (harbinger of death) and is told by Sakaki, “Fate is cruel... It can be said both you and he are its victims.” Soma’s hidden past is revealed to him, but Lenka...

Operation Meteorite, a plan to lure Aragami with a newly developed guiding device, is critical to the completion of the Aegis Plan. Lenka is unable to join the unit due to adjustments that must be made on his God Arc, but Lindow recommends him to command the advance base camp. Alisa rejoins the unit, but the others seem to feel uncomfortable around her. Operation Meteorite starts successfully, but suddenly the Aragami turn away from the guiding devices and head northwest. Lindow is sent to do reconnaissance and realizes that the Aragami are converging on Asyl, the settlement that Lindow has been helping.
